1. whatare the units of Electronic conductance?​

Answer»

The electrical conductivity UNITS are siemens PER metre, S⋅m-1. The siemens ALSO used to be referred to as a mho - this is the reciprocal of a an ohm, and this is inferred by spelling ohm backwards. Conductance is the reciprocal of resistance and one siemens is equal to the reciprocal of one ohm

Explanation:

About electric conductivity : Unit of electric conductivity

The unit of electrical conductivity is, by definition, the reciprocal of electrical resistivity, S/m (siemens per METER) in SI units.
